1. The above answer is absolutely right. But is only in the
case of assessee (employee in this case) is being other than
senior citizen and woman.

2. Here no other deductions or savings been furnished.
The amount subject to deduction of TDS comes to Rs. 20000/-.

But Rs. 800/- per month = 9600/- is allowed as transport
allowance. And HRA is also to be calculated according to the
information furnished by employee.

3. Savings in the form of lic, etc. also deductible from the
taxable amount.

After deducting all these above there may be no need to
deduct TDS from his/her salary.
